Class: Fastlane::GitResult

Inherits:
Object
  • Object
show all
Defined in:
lib/fastlane/plugin/emerge/helper/emerge_helper.rb

Instance Attribute Summary collapse

Instance Method Summary collapse

Constructor Details

#initialize(sha:, base_sha:, previous_sha:, branch:, pr_number: nil, repo_name: nil) ⇒ GitResult

Returns a new instance of GitResult.



10
11
12
13
14
15
16
17
# File 'lib/fastlane/plugin/emerge/helper/emerge_helper.rb', line 10

def initialize(sha:, base_sha:, previous_sha:, branch:, pr_number: nil, repo_name: nil)
  @pr_number = pr_number
  @sha = sha
  @base_sha = base_sha
  @previous_sha = previous_sha
  @branch = branch
  @repo_name = repo_name
end

Instance Attribute Details

#base_shaObject

Returns the value of attribute base_sha.



8
9
10
# File 'lib/fastlane/plugin/emerge/helper/emerge_helper.rb', line 8

def base_sha
  @base_sha
end

#branchObject

Returns the value of attribute branch.



8
9
10
# File 'lib/fastlane/plugin/emerge/helper/emerge_helper.rb', line 8

def branch
  @branch
end

#pr_numberObject

Returns the value of attribute pr_number.



8
9
10
# File 'lib/fastlane/plugin/emerge/helper/emerge_helper.rb', line 8

def pr_number
  @pr_number
end

#previous_shaObject

Returns the value of attribute previous_sha.



8
9
10
# File 'lib/fastlane/plugin/emerge/helper/emerge_helper.rb', line 8

def previous_sha
  @previous_sha
end

#repo_nameObject

Returns the value of attribute repo_name.



8
9
10
# File 'lib/fastlane/plugin/emerge/helper/emerge_helper.rb', line 8

def repo_name
  @repo_name
end

#shaObject

Returns the value of attribute sha.



8
9
10
# File 'lib/fastlane/plugin/emerge/helper/emerge_helper.rb', line 8

def sha
  @sha
end